Your Grand Teak Wood Floor Mandir from Harishyam Arts is a masterpiece of traditional craftsmanship and durable teak wood, designed to grace your home for generations. To maintain its beauty and structural integrity, it is important to follow some essential care practices.

Teak wood is naturally resistant to pests and moisture, but it thrives best when kept in a stable environment away from extreme humidity or direct sunlight. Prolonged exposure to sunlight may cause the wood to dry out and fade, while excess moisture can lead to swelling or warping. Therefore, place your mandir in a well-ventilated, dry area of your home, avoiding locations like bathrooms or near open windows where weather elements can affect it.

Regular dusting with a soft, dry cloth helps preserve the intricate carvings on the shikhara and peacock pillars, preventing dust buildup that can dull the finish. If necessary, use a slightly damp cloth followed immediately by a dry one to remove stubborn dust, but avoid soaking the wood.

To protect and enhance the wood’s natural sheen, you can apply teak-specific wood polish or natural beeswax periodically, approximately every 4 to 6 months. This treatment nourishes the wood, replenishes its oils, and offers an additional protective layer against minor scratches or environmental wear.

While performing pooja rituals, always use trays or holders for diyas and incense to prevent accidental oil or wax spills on the wood surface. Any residue should be wiped away promptly to avoid staining.

By following these care tips, your handcrafted teak wood temple will remain a stunning centerpiece of spirituality and elegance, keeping its rich, warm appearance and intricate detailing intact for many years.
